All right—so I’m kicking things off today with a simple reminder:

You have the power.

The power to bring life, or the power to bring death—and it all rests in the words you speak.


Proverbs explains it best and says it plainly:


“The tongue can bring death or life; those who love to talk will reap the consequences.”

Proverbs 18:21 (NLT)


Now, the word consequences might sound negative, but in this case, it’s not necessarily bad—it just means there will be results. What you say will create something. Words are never neutral. They build or they break.


And today, I want to focus less on the words we speak about others and more on the words we speak about ourselves.


Let me paint a picture for you:


If the words you spoke about yourself were visible—if words that brought life appeared as white light on you, and words that brought death appeared as dark markings—what would you look like?

• Would you be glowing bright?

• Would there be shadows mixed with light?

• Would your body show signs of damage from self-spoken defeat?


The truth is, as children of God, we are made in His image—and if we are made in His image, we should reflect His image.


But if the words we’re feeding ourselves aren’t aligned with who He says we are, we need to ask:

Are we truly reflecting Him?


Today, choose life.


Choose freedom. Choose healing. Choose wholeness.


You don’t have to go searching far to know who you are—it’s already written in His Word.


So speak it.


Make declarations over yourself. Remind your spirit of what God already says about you.


You have the power.

Use it to speak the life you want to see.
